
Current Crossbearer Protocol Very often, you’ll be the most proficient server – so DON’T be shy about directing and/or mentoring the other servers diplomatically. (Folded hands, singing, responding, and using Worship aids and Blue books, etc) During the procession, hold the cross as straight and as high as possible. Walk with reverent pace as you lead the procession. After you reach the carpeting, count to 5 before bowing- then continue through the sacristy door. It’s important to sit in the chair closest to the back door. Please use worship aid to sing the Gloria and Psalm and blue book for the Creed. After the intercessions, go through the hallway quickly- to retrieve the chalice and bring it to the right of center on the altar- to start the Altar preparation. BOW to Father, after you back off the altar. While the torches are at the Altar, move closer to altar and be alert to retrieve the tray from the Altar as soon as possible- after it is empty. Father may be ready to “wash hands” while torches are still at the Altar. Make sure “Book” has moved closer to altar and is prepared to “wash hands”. After the tray is at credence table, proceed to the kneelers to the position closest to Ambo (so you have the best view of the altar – to ring the Sanctus Bells.) After the “Holy, Holy, Holy”, kneel and be alert- to ring the bells– as Father begins to extends his hands over the chalice (which can occur quickly). For Fr Jordan, your cue is- he will remove the pall from the chalice- just before extending his hands. (I prefer you NOT lean over touching the bells- before it’s time to ring them. PLEASE ring the bells vigorously- for a count of two.) Each Elevation includes 3 vigorous rings- with a distinct pause of silence between each ring. Again, there is no need to lean over, touching the bells while Father is consecrating each substance. The last words Father says before elevating the Sacred Body are “This will be given up for you” The last words before raising the Precious Blood are “ Do this in memory of Me” After the Sign of Peace, make sure the remaining communion bowl(s) are delivered Revised 2/13/20 1 of 2 to the Altar by the server closest to the credence table. Then, kneel- as Eucharistic ministers arrive- so all of you are kneeling before Fr says “Behold the Lamb of God”. As Father drinks from the chalice, stand up to be prepared to receive yours. After drinking from the cup, kneel to thank God, for your many gifts and blessings- for about a minute. Then, take the ciboria covers to the right side of altar but leave the chalice. Then hang back, with a torch, (sitting or kneeling) until Father BEGINS to return from communion. Bring a cruet with you and move 2 steps from Altar. Be alert for a full bow as the tabernacle closes. (The torch gathers the 2 stacked ciboria to take them to credence table.) Then, with a cruet, step on Altar to pour water over Father’s fingers in chalice (or ciborium) - to assist in its purification. When finished, gather remaining ciborium and return both the cruet and ciborium to the credence table. Then return to one step off the altar- to retrieve dressed chalice- when it is ready and return to “your” chair. After Father concludes the mass, gather your cross to lead our servers to prepare for the procession. Hold the cross high and face the altar until Father genuflects- then BOW and turn (to walk reverently) with eyes straight ahead. After the procession, remain at back of church until singing stops. When you arrive in sacristy, return the Sanctus bells to the priest sacristy and lead a short review of- “lessons to learn” and “well done”s. After a 10:15 mass, please make sure there is nothing out of place in the sanctuary- as if, no mass took place. Revised 2/13/20 2 of 2 .
